Cube Group is a purpose-driven consultancy with an award-winning culture and commitment to being a great place to work. We put our clients' needs at the forefront of everything we do, ensuring that we deliver high-quality results that meet their goals.
We offer a range of services including strategic planning, policy development, organisational design and performance, program evaluation, transformation and implementation, commercial and financial advice, project management, and stakeholder and community engagement.
Our team is passionate about making a difference in the world and we are committed to working with clients who share our values. We are proud to be an independently certified B Corporation and hold ourselves to an unwavering commitment to integrity and ethics.
We have delivered hundreds of projects across Australia's public purpose sector in verticals such as health, human services, justice and community safety, education and learning, economic and regional development.

The opportunity
We're looking for skilled consultants with demonstrated experience in professional services who are eager to work on diverse projects with our purpose driven clients. As a consultant you can expect to work on multiple projects across sectors, helping clients to define their problems and find solutions. Typical activities include:
Working directly with clients to understand their needs and develop tailored solutions. Shaping compelling strategies, business cases, operating models, frameworks, reports and recommendations for decision-makers. Undertaking qualitative and quantitative analysis to support client deliverables. Scanning the internal and external environments of our clients to identify strategic opportunities, challenges, strengths and areas for improvement. Analysing and benchmarking client data to identify trends and translating them into insights and recommendations. Coordinating and co-facilitating client engagement (workshops, interviews, roundtables, surveys, conferences, forums etc) that brings together stakeholders across industry, government, and the broader community. Distilling key themes and shaping next-step roadmaps. Managing project fundamentals- time, cost, scope, quality, issues/risks and status reporting.
